Apa Hotel Asakusa Kaminarimon Minami, located at 2 Chome-9-1 Kaminarimon, Taito City, Tokyo 111-0034, Japan, is a charming hotel nestled in the heart of one of Tokyo's most vibrant districts. Just a four-minute walk from the historic Sensō-ji Temple, this hotel offers guests an unparalleled opportunity to immerse themselves in the rich cultural heritage of the area. The hotel’s modern design combines comfort with elegance, creating a welcoming atmosphere that makes every guest feel at home.
The rooms at Apa Hotel Asakusa Kaminarimon Minami are thoughtfully designed to ensure maximum comfort and relaxation. Each room features a private bathroom equipped with a bathtub and shower, air conditioning, and a refrigerator, making it an ideal choice for travelers seeking convenience. Guests can enjoy high-speed Wi-Fi, ensuring they stay connected throughout their stay.
This hotel boasts an array of unique amenities, including a hot tub—one of the few in the area—which offers a relaxing retreat after a day of exploring Tokyo. Other features include a full-service laundry, baggage storage, and a convenience store for all your needs.
Accessibility is a breeze with nearby public transport options, including Asakusa Station, which is just a four-minute walk away. Guests can reach Narita International Airport in about 62 minutes via public transport or 60 minutes by taxi, while Haneda Airport is a quick 28-minute taxi ride away.
Health and safety measures are prioritized at the hotel, with thorough cleaning protocols in place to ensure guests' well-being during their stay.
For those looking to engage with local culture, there are plenty of activities nearby, including visiting the iconic Tokyo Skytree, just 10 minutes away, or exploring the bustling Akihabara Electric Town within 12 minutes.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y the Ueno Zoological Gardens, located just 11 minutes from the hotel, or take a leisurely stroll through the scenic gardens of the Imperial Palace, a 14-minute journey.

Rooms are very small, fairly affordable, very clean, minimum amenities.It states, video selection has over a hundred movies, does not mention 80% of them are just Japanese porn.Very clean and close to the Temple district, awesome cleaning staff, and plenty of restaurants nearby.Bad news is none of the nearby restaurants are particularly awesome.Electric sockets were not particularly fast.

Perfect location, excelent service. The rooms are too small - it is hard to get out of the bed without stepping on the other person. Located in Asakusa, next to all key attractions

The transportation is convenient, which is very convenient if you are going out for a whole day.The hotel also has ice cubes and a microwave.If you go to an extended stay hotel, there will be a laundry and drying shop not too long away.This pillow is very good to sleep on

Very close to Kaminarimon Gate,You can get there within five minutes on foot by subway.The room is small but has everything you needThe only drawback may be that there is only one elevator
